We each have something to give and someone we can impact.  Today we are joined by communications expert Dr. Louise Mahler - encouraging women to speak up AND often!  In a digital world, body language has never been more important! In this episode, you’ll hear all the Do’s and Don’ts around your face, hands and body. There will be things that are obvious like ‘smiling’ but we guarantee you’ll learn something new! Listen in to improve your overall body language; particularly for product demonstrations and public speaking. You may even learn a thing or two from Anchorman and Zoolander… Dr. Louise Mahler is a Communications Expert, 2021 Keynote Speaker of The Year and 2-time Top 30 Global Guru.
